SNOW GUARDS


We have the largest selection of snow guards and roof snow retention devices on the internet.

New arrivals

    • Free shipping

    Direct Democracy

    0.0
    Add first review
    Not rated yet
    • $19.00
    Sorry, we only have 493 of that item available

Top News

All news

Footer navigation